"fronteiro" meaning in Galician

See fronteiro in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Adjective

IPA: [fɾonˈtejɾʊ] Forms: fronteira [feminine], fronteiros [masculine, plural], fronteiras [feminine, plural]
Etymology: From Old Galician-Portuguese fronteiro (13th century, Cantigas de Santa Maria), from fronte (“front”) + -eiro.   1. front Synonyms: dianteiro

  2. border
